Narrative description: 
British peace negotiations with the United States, France, Spain, and Holland. Images include: Charles James Fox (a fox) as a chef; America as an Indian; France; Spain; Holland; Admiral Augustus Keppel; William Petty, Earl Shelburne; Charles Lennox, Duke of Richmond; Henry Seymour, General Henry Seymour Conway.
